Michigan State Football Coaching Changes: Jonathan Smith Fired, Pat Fitzgerald Expected to Replace

Michigan State University has made a significant change in its football program by firing head coach Jonathan Smith after just two seasons. This decision follows a series of disappointing performances that continued a decade-long decline for the Spartans. Reports indicate that Michigan State is swiftly moving to hire former Northwestern head coach Pat Fitzgerald as Smith’s replacement. Fitzgerald, who has a long history in the Big Ten and previously coached Northwestern for 17 seasons, is seen as a high-risk, high-reward candidate. While some sources praise his potential fit for the program, others warn of controversies associated with his past. As the Spartans look to revitalize their football legacy, the decision to hire Fitzgerald marks a bold gamble for the university.
